Discover the Best Python Libraries for Artificial Intelligence

In the intricate, algorithm-dominated domain of Artificial Intelligence (AI), Python1 has emerged as an essential language. Python is celebrated for its simplicity and readability while handling complex computational tasks, cementing its place as a top choice for developers and data scientists.

Unveiling the Best Python Libraries for AI

Python’s popularity transcends its simplicity, owed in part to its diverse selection of third-party libraries. These libraries play a crucial role in harnessing the immense potential of AI2. The best Python libraries for Artificial Intelligence include TensorFlow, Keras, Pandas, SciKit-Learn, and PyTorch. Each provides valuable functionalities and techniques that simplify tasks such as data manipulation, linear regression, and deep learning.

An Examination of TensorFlow and Keras: Best Python Libraries for AI

TensorFlow, a creation from Google’s Brain project3, is vital in the building and training of large-scale neural networks. On the other hand, Keras, a Python wrapper for TensorFlow, offers an intuitive interface for developing deep learning models while simplifying complex TensorFlow operations4. Both are considered among the best Python libraries for Artificial Intelligence.

The Role of Pandas and SciKit-Learn in AI

Pandas, well-known for its data manipulation capabilities, is a necessary tool for data scientists5. SciKit-Learn is instrumental in the application of machine learning algorithms. It provides support for a variety of machine learning concepts, from linear regression to clustering6, further solidifying its position among the best Python Libraries for AI.

Spotlight on PyTorch: An Ideal Python Library for AI

PyTorch, brought to life by Facebook’s AI Research lab7, has carved out a name for itself in the field of deep learning. With its dynamic computational graph and efficient memory usage, PyTorch holds a significant place in the development of AI, marking it as one of the best Python Libraries for AI development.
